Warning Signs You Need Thermal Imaging Leak Detection

Don’t ignore these warning signs of water damage. Early detection is key to preventing costly repairs. Here are some common warning signs to look out for: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

If you notice a persistent musty odor in your home, it could be a sign of water damage. Don’t ignore it. Our team can help you detect the source of the odor and repair any underlying issues.

Water Stains on Your Ceiling

Water stains on your ceiling can be a sign of a hidden leak. Don’t wait until it’s too late. Our team can help you detect and repair the leak before it causes further damage.

Warped or Discolored Flooring

Warped or discolored flooring can be a sign of water damage. Don’t ignore it. Our team can help you detect the source of the damage and repair any underlying issues.

Increased Water Bills

Increased water bills can be a sign of a hidden leak. Don’t wait until it’s too late. Our team can help you detect and repair the leak before it causes further damage.

Visible Water Damage

Visible water damage can be a sign of a serious issue. Don’t ignore it. Our team can help you detect the source of the damage and repair any underlying issues.

Thermal Imaging Leak Detection Cost in Oxford, MS

The cost of Thermal Imaging Leak Detection in Oxford, MS, varies depending on the severity of the issue,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will provide a personalized estimate based on your specific needs. Here’s a rough estimate of the costs involved: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Initial Inspection $100 – $500 Size of affected area, severity of issue
Thermal Imaging Scan $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area, complexity of issue
Leak Detection and Repair $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, severity of issue
Drying and Dehumidification $300 – $1,500 Size of affected area, severity of issue
More Services (e.g., mold remediation) $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, severity of issue

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ment. We offer free estimates to ensure that you’re fully informed about the costs involved.
